Cool Must rant!!!!!!!!

The other day after we had closed down A younger guy and presumably his girlfriend knock on the door. They had a tandam axle cargo trailer with a bad wheel bearing. They were not fron here and did not know anyone around here. They asked me if I could help. the others that I work with shrugged and said" I can't fix it." So I guess i'm the only one left, I had been working 13 hours and just wanted to go back to the apartment. I felt sorry for them and I opened the bay door and broke out the jack and impact. The said they were hungry and were going to walk a fast food place. I told them that would be fine They got back about 20 minutes later and asked if I was through. I said no and told them the parts they needed. Doh! thier only truck is hooked to a 6500lb trailer. So i took the guy and got the stuff to fix it, in my car. I got it , and she sighed and said how much longer is this going to take??? AAARRRGGGG! I got them back on the road and no money, not even a thank you for my time. A similar thing happened again today!
